Transaction 076f56928eac04eb1256a7c816cfcfedae5c3a989c77e64e8637a9cc71ca322b

1 Input
2 Outputs
  • 076f56928eac04eb1256a7c816cfcfedae5c3a989c77e64e8637a9cc71ca322b:0
  • value  874352
    address  39rJsaURSzSRxXsQzGypysVjVBp4AQFiGC
  • 076f56928eac04eb1256a7c816cfcfedae5c3a989c77e64e8637a9cc71ca322b:1
  • value  1150654
    address  39AFg9a3M74kKvcWc7nQ7aCpbPbsonuFbj